Middleby (MIDD) just caught fresh attention after Jefferies shifted to a Buy rating, pointing to momentum in its Commercial Foodservice business, healthier margins, and ongoing support from share repurchases and insider buying.
See our latest analysis for Middleby.
The Jefferies upgrade seems to have lit a fire under the stock, with a 1 day share price return of 9.27 percent and a 7 day share price return of 17.56 percent, even though the 1 year total shareholder return is still slightly negative. This suggests that positive momentum is only just starting to rebuild.

Yet with net income still in the red and the share price now racing toward analyst targets, the key question is whether Middleby remains undervalued or if the market is already baking in the next leg of growth.
With Middleby last closing at $140.96 against a narrative fair value near $159.38, the story leans toward upside if execution holds.
The analyst price target for Middleby has inched higher to approximately $159 from about $157, as analysts factor in modestly stronger long term revenue growth and a notable uplift in expected profit margins, even as they temper future valuation multiples following recent target revisions and the ongoing review of the Residential Kitchen business.
